Mg₁Ga₁Pd₂ is an intermetallic compound combining magnesium, gallium, and palladium in a fixed stoichiometric ratio. This is a research-phase material studied primarily for its potential in electronic and photonic applications, rather than a commercialized engineering material; it belongs to the broader family of ternary intermetallics that exhibit interesting band structure and catalytic properties.
